The Saint – Design District builds its identity around high-end Mediterranean-inspired dining, balancing theatrical hospitality with the upscale nightlife culture that defines the Design District after dark.

The menu leans heavily into seafood towers, steaks, handmade pastas, Mediterranean-inspired plates, luxury cocktails, decadent desserts, and highly visual presentations layered with rich textures and bold flavors.
